Amy Adamczyk completed her doctoral degree in sociology from the Pennsylvania State University in 2005. A native of rural Wisconsin, she joined the Department of Sociology in 2007 and currently teaches criminology. Her scholarly interests focus on social theory, religious contextual influences on delinquency and reproductive behaviors, and cross-national differences in attitudes about crime and deviance. Her publications have appeared in Justice Quarterly, Social Science Research, and Social Science Quarterly. |
